Web10 apr. 2024 · Sponsored Link. The USPS will raise rates in July, citing inflation and a "previously defective pricing model." The Postal Regulatory Commission (PRC) will review the rates, which, if approved, would raise First Class Mail by approximately 5.4% since it last raised rates in January. Rates for Media Mail and Library Mail will rise by 7.4%. Amazon announced on Wednesday that it will add a 5% “fuel and inflation surcharge” to the fees it charges third-party merchants that use the e-commerce giant’s fulfillment services to counteract rising costs.
